Hi, my name is Patty Bean. I am here to help you live your best life.  
 
After a 31-year career as a postmaster, I began my life's calling as a Licensed Massage Therapist and Coach. I'm a National Board-Certified Health and Wellness Coach, and a Master Certified Wayfinder Life Coach.  I am also a certified Mindfulness Meditation Teacher, a 200-hour Certified Holden QiGong Instructor, and a eRYT-200 Yoga teacher.

The Well Being Pillars

These 6 pillars are the core to becoming your best self

Chill

Focuses on meditation, heart coherence, sound therapy, and prioritizing sleep.

Connect

Focuses on spending time with friends and family, participating in church or spiritual gatherings, and engaging in hobbies.

Move

Focuses on practicing yoga, Tai Chi Easy, QiGong, and strength training.

Play

Focuses on spending time in nature, appreciating beauty, hiking, and playing pickleball.

Nourish

Focuses on eating whole foods and plants, taking supplements, cooking at home, and making healthy choices while away from home.

Purpose

Focuses on doing work you love, finding fulfillment in any job, volunteering, and making a difference in someone's life.
